The Rise of a Rap Star
Blac Youngsta's journey to stardom began with humble beginnings. Born and raised in Memphis, Tennessee, he was exposed to the harsh realities of life in the streets. However, it was his passion for music that initially drew him to the industry. He began writing rhymes and performing at local events, which eventually caught the attention of prominent record labels.
Signing with Cash Money Records, Blac Youngsta released his debut album "I Swear to God" in 2016. The album's moderate success laid the groundwork for his future projects, which would propel him to fame. His second album, "I Swear to God 2," released in 2018, featured popular singles like "Booty" and "Lil Durk Diss." The album's commercial success and critical acclaim marked a turning point in Blac Youngsta's career, cementing his position as a rising star in the rap world.
The Business of Hip-Hop: Understanding Blac Youngsta's Net Worth
Blac Youngsta's estimated net worth of 8.6 million and climbing may seem impressive, but what factors have contributed to this figure? The answer lies in the diverse revenue streams available to rappers. From album sales and merchandise to touring and endorsement deals, the opportunities for earning money in the music industry are vast.
Album sales and streaming revenue are the primary sources of income for many rappers, including Blac Youngsta. His music has been streamed millions of times on platforms like Spotify, Apple Music, and YouTube. Merchandise sales, such as T-shirts, hats, and other promotional items, also contribute to his net worth. Furthermore, touring and live performances provide additional revenue streams, as well as the potential for endorsement deals with prominent brands.
